Problems solved by technology

However, the original technology has the following disadvantages: 1. Metal ions are introduced in the combined state of alkoxide, and the preparation of metal alkoxide is difficult and expensive, which directly leads to an increase in the cost of the three-way catalyst; Most of the organic substances such as alcohol are harmful to the human body and do not meet the requirements of environmental protection; 3. The preparation process of the alkoxide sol-gel method is relatively complicated and the production cycle is long, which is not conducive to industrial production
The existence of these defects makes the preparation of traditional sol-gel three-way catalysts remain in the laboratory stage, and there is still a certain distance from the marketization

Embodiment 1

[0017] ①Take 588 grams of Al(NO 3 ) 3 9H 2 O, 25.2 g Ce(NO 3 ) 3 ·6H 2 O, 5.32 g La(NO 3 ) 3 ·6H 2 O, 10.2 g Ba(NO 3 ) 2 , dissolved in 800ml of water to obtain a mixed solution;

[0018] ②Take 250 grams of citric acid and dissolve it in 500ml of alcohol;

[0019] ③ Slowly add the alcohol solution of citric acid into the mixed solution obtained in step ① under stirring conditions, and continue to stir at 300r / min at 40°C for 5 hours, and then stir at 80°C until the solution is completely gelled ;

[0020] ④ drying the sol at 110° C. under an air atmosphere for 12 hours, and then roasting at 600° C. for 4 hours to obtain a loose foam carrier material;

[0021] ⑤ Dissolve 3.2 grams of H in 50ml of distilled water 2 PtCl 6 +1.4 g of Rh(NO 3 ) 3 ;

Abstract

The present invention relates to a car tail gas three-effect catalyst, in the concrete, it is a method for preparing three-effective tail gas catalyst by using sol-gel method. Said method includes the following steps: dissolving soluble salts of Al, Ce, La and Ba in water to obtain mixed solution, under the condition of stirring slowly adding the citric acid alcohol solution as complexing agent into the above-mentioned mixed solution to obtain sol, drying sol and roasting to obtain carrier material, vacuum impregnating carrier material with aqueous solution of soluble salts of Pt and Rh, drying, hydrogen gas reduction to obtain the noble metal catalyst powder.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a three-way catalyst for automobile tail gas, in particular to a method for preparing a three-way tail gas catalyst by a sol-gel method. Background technique [0002] Automobile exhaust is one of the main sources of air pollution, and a large amount of exhaust gas makes the living environment of human beings deteriorate sharply. Therefore, in order to protect the environment, many countries are actively formulating and enforcing tail gas emission regulations. With the enhancement of public environmental awareness and the development of technology, emission regulations are becoming more and more stringent. The ultimate goal is to make cars reach zero emission standards. The United States, the European Community and Japan have always been leading the world in research on emission technology, and the emission standards they implement are relatively strict.
